Kedarnath Landslide: Two Dead, Three Injured
Rescue teams rush to aid injured pilgrims in Uttarakhand after a deadly landslide incident.

Image: Instagram
A tragic landslide on the popular trekking route to the ancient Kedarnath shrine in Uttarakhand has claimed the lives of two people and left three others injured. The disaster, which occurred on Wednesday, has sent shockwaves through the region known for its spiritual significance and rugged landscapes.
Rescue Efforts Underway
Rescue teams, including the District Disaster Response Force (DDRF) and local police units, have been mobilized to the affected area. Their primary task is to provide emergency medical assistance and clear the debris that has blocked parts of the hiking trail. According to reliable reports, early investigations indicate that the victims lost their lives when rolling boulders, dislodged by the landslide, struck them and caused a fatal fall into a gorge. The three injured pilgrims have already been transported to Gaurikund for treatment, highlighting the urgency and scale of the rescue operations.
Local authorities are urging visitors and trekkers to remain cautious during this period of inclement weather. The region, known for unpredictable terrain and heavy monsoons in recent years, is no stranger to such natural calamities. Officials have advised that all non-essential trekking in the area be postponed until the rescue operations are complete and safety is re-established.
